Transaction ef3416613bd8218741c0804c527483ca83811437022c73f196c7483dc9f61fbb
1 Input
1 Output
-
ef3416613bd8218741c0804c527483ca83811437022c73f196c7483dc9f61fbb:0
- value
- 398592
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bd58db6c2e9837e6e457a8ca4a2cc7d18d5bbc5
- address
- bc1ql02cmdkzaxphumj902x2fgkv05vdtw792ulecj